## Service Accounts: Snapshot Testing

Hey release folks — the Driftplane snapshot suite for our UI components runs under a dedicated service account, not anyone's personal login. That account can write baseline images to the Cobblenest artifact store and nothing else, so don't reuse it for deploys. Baselines only update on tagged release branches; feature branches just compare. If you're wiring up a new pipeline stage, the account authenticates to Cobblenest using the key below.

service key, tadup-tahog: zpat7_wB1tnEL

Welcome to the Cartwheel logistics team. The weekly fuel-usage report for the Norvale depot fleet pulls telemetry from the Tankline collector, normalizes liters-per-route, and flags vehicles drifting more than 8% above baseline. Watch for gaps when trucks park underground — the collector drops samples, and the report backfills them Monday mornings. The reconciliation script must run before distribution, or totals will be wrong. Going forward, questions, anomalies, and schedule changes should be directed to the new report owner.

named custodian: Belius Casath Ulaix Sorius

## Changelog — Tidemark Widget 3.2

Defaults changed. Read before touching anything.

- Refresh interval now hourly, not every 15 min. Harbor feeds from the Pellisport aggregator throttle aggressive polling.
- Lunar-offset correction is on by default. Disable only for legacy Kestrel Bay deployments.
- Chart units default to metric. The imperial fallback flag is deprecated and will be removed in 3.4.
- Cache eviction is now time-based, not size-based.

New installs should start from the default configuration values listed below.

config for kahap-taweg:
oliox:
  pin: 8609
  tenant: casath
  seal: seal_632a4a6f
  metrics_host: metrics.oliox.nelvrogrid.example
  standby_team: keleth
  escalation: briiel-oliwyn
  nonce: e2397c